Ingredients
2 cup Kabuli Chana (White Chickpeas)
1 cup Dates
1 Onion
1 cup Homemade tomato puree
6 cloves Garlic - minced
1 inch Ginger - minced
1 tablespoon Cumin powder (Jeera)
1 tablespoon Coriander Powder (Dhania)
1/2 teaspoon Cinnamon Powder (Dalchini)
2 tablespoons Paprika powder
Salt - to taste
2 tablespoons Extra Virgin Olive Oil
Mint Leaves (Pudina) - for garnish
Couscous - as required (cooked)
